Ceremony is a 2010 American film directed byMax Winkler, in his feature filmdirectorial debut.[2] The film starsMichael Angarano,Uma Thurman,Lee Pace,Rebecca Mader andReece Thompson. It premiered at theToronto International Film Festival in September 2010.[3] The film was released on VOD on March 4, 2011, and opened in theaters April 8, 2011.
Sam Davis (Michael Angarano) convinces his former best friend to spend a weekend with him to rekindle their friendship at an elegant beachside estate owned by a famous documentary filmmaker (Lee Pace). It soon becomes clear that Sam is secretly infatuated with the filmmaker's fiancée, Zoe (Uma Thurman), and that his true intention is to thwart their impending nuptials. As Sam's plan begins to unravel, he is forced to realize how complicated love and friendship can be.
As of July 2022[update],Ceremony holds a 39% approval rating onRotten Tomatoes, based on 36 reviews with an average rating of 4.86/10.[4]
